Error Log Related ModulesRelated Directivescorehref="./mod/core.html#errorlog">ErrorLogErrorLogFormatLogLevel The server error log, whose name and location is set by the ErrorLog directive, is the most important log file. Common Log Format A typical configuration for the access log might look as follows. For example, to rotate the logs every 24 hours, you can use: CustomLog "|/usr/local/apache/bin/rotatelogs /var/log/access_log 86400" common Notice that quotes are used to enclose the entire command that will be called thanks for the help apache-2.2 logging share|improve this question asked Jul 5 '11 at 8:27 whitelord migrated from Jul 5 '11 at 11:16 This question came from our site for

This is easily accomplished with the help of environment variables. To log "0" for no content, use %B instead. The format string may also contain the special control characters "\n" for new-line and "\t" for tab. Although we have just shown that conditional logging is very powerful and flexible, it is not the only way to control the contents of the logs.

Using Elemental Attunement to destroy a castle aligning shapes in latex Is there an English idiom for provocative titles, something like "yellow title"?

First, an environment variable must be set to indicate that the request meets certain conditions. The format is: [day/month/year:hour:minute:second zone]
day = 2*digit
month = 3*letter
year = 4*digit
hour = 2*digit
minute = 2*digit
second = 2*digit
What commercial flight route has the biggest number of (minimum possible) stops/layovers from A to B? Apache Error Log Cpanel Many of the "errors" Apache records are typically minor, such as a visitor requesting a file that doesn't exist.

The next step is to analyze this information to produce useful statistics. Php Log File Location Puzzler - which spacecraft(s) (actually) incorporated wooden structural elements? share|improve this answer edited Apr 19 '12 at 9:00 Community♦ 1 answered Nov 24 '10 at 19:18 misterben 3,98321523 Yep. If the status code for the request (see below) is 401, then this value should not be trusted because the user is not yet authenticated.

Defining Custom Logs In the previous section, the line describing the "access.log" file uses a different directive than the preceding log lines. Ubuntu Php Error Log It can be used as follows. Arithmetic or Geometric sequence? Access Log Related ModulesRelated Directivesmod_log_configmod_setenvifCustomLogLogFormatSetEnvIf The server access log records all requests processed by the server.

Php Log File Location

For the access log, there is a very good compromise. In other cases, a literal "-" will be logged instead. Apache Error Log Format This gives the site that the client reports having been referred from. (This should be the page that links to or includes /apache_pb.gif). "Mozilla/4.08 [en] (Win98; I ;Nav)" (\"%{User-agent}i\") The User-Agent Apache Log Example Where does Apache Keep Its Logs?

A typical log message follows: [Fri Sep 09 10:42:29.902022 2011] [core:error] [pid 35708:tid 4328636416] [client] File does not exist: /usr/local/apache2/htdocs/favicon.ico The first item in the log entry is the date Note that this path is relative to the path mentioned in #1, so it would be /etc/httpd/conf/httpd.conf. -D SERVER_CONFIG_FILE="conf/httpd.conf" Error log is here. -D DEFAULT_ERRORLOG="logs/error_log" NOTE: This one might be a

From : There are two type of apache httpd server log files: Error Logs All apache errors / diagnostic information other errors found while serving requests are logged to this Unknown symbol on schematic (Circle with "M" underlined) Why is 10W resistor getting hot with only 6.5W running through it? The "LogFormat" command defines a custom format for logs that can be called using the "CustomLog" directive as we saw in the virtual host definition. weblink The process-id is for use by the administrator in restarting and terminating the daemon by sending signals to the parent process; on Windows, use the -k command line option instead.

Multiple Access Logs Multiple access logs can be created simply by specifying multiple CustomLog directives in the configuration file. Php Error Log Ubuntu Nginx Unknown symbol on schematic (Circle with "M" underlined) Why does typography ruin the user experience? Therefore, it is possible for malicious clients to insert control-characters in the log files, so care must be taken in dealing with raw logs.

What makes an actor an A-lister Puzzler - which spacecraft(s) (actually) incorporated wooden structural elements?

It uses "CustomLog" to specify the access.log location: CustomLog ${APACHE_LOG_DIR}/access.log combined This directive takes the following syntax: CustomLog log_location log_format The log format in this example is "combined". Hot Network Questions Are there textual deviations between the Dead Sea Scrolls and the Old Testament? If you're experiencing web server difficulties, or you just want to see what Apache is doing, log files should be your first stop. Apache_log_dir The Apache HTTP Server includes a simple program called rotatelogs for this purpose.

Literal characters may also be placed in the format string and will be copied directly into the log output. LogFormat "%h %l %u %t \"%r\" %>s %b" common CustomLog logs/access_log common CustomLog logs/referer_log "%{Referer}i -> %U" CustomLog logs/agent_log "%{User-agent}i" This example also shows that it is not necessary to define